We're trying to choose new coping for a pool remodel that will probably include a salt system. I've heard all the horror stories about the salt tearing up flagstone, limestone, etc. Does anyone know if certain types of stone are more dense, or otherwise resistant to this problem? We are looking at Oklahoma flagstone, Calico (limestone??), or Arkansas flagstone.
Also, has anyone had any luck using sealers to delay this decay?

I wrote a little bit about this topic on this post. Sealing will always help, but it is the softer stones that would be more susceptible to damage and this can be roughly determined by the water bead test mentioned in the post. Rinsing off the area where splash-out or dripping occurs will also help a lot. anyone use a cast stone product around the pool? We're looking at a cast stone from Noble Tile that they said would probably be more resistant to decay than limestone or flagstone. They also said to stay away from travertine, which is contrary to what I've read on other posts. Now I'm really confused! Anyway, I think the cast stone is closer to concrete than it is to stone as far as its composition, so I am guessing that would be a good thing?? As I said though, COMPLETE guess!
 
If by "cast stone" they are referring to some of the manufactured compressed stones including limestone, then yes these are very hard -- much harder than the native stone from which they are made. They are much more impervious to water and should be much more resistant to salt water damage. Do the water drop bead test referred to in the link I gave in my previous post. That will confirm the water resistance of the stone. If the stone is impervious to water, then it should not be affected by salt water either. The salt can't get into the stone if water can't get in.
